Eslint With Prettier, On some cases they collide. 1, which is a patch release upgrade of ESLint. This lets you use you...
Eslint With Prettier, On some cases they collide. 1, which is a patch release upgrade of ESLint. This lets you use your favorite shareable config . This The ESLint Flat Config Manager skill is designed to help developers navigate the transition to ESLint 9 and the new flat configuration system. Does Prettier replace ESLint? No, ESLint and Prettier have different jobs: ESLint is a linter (looking for problematic patterns) and Prettier is a code formatter. ) eslint-config-prettier is always the last config entry to disable ESLint rules that conflict with Prettier eslint-config-prettier 8. Using Prettier as an ESLint rule has its How to combine Prettier and ESLint for VSCode, Sublime, or any other IDE/editor. 5, last published: 3 months ago. Features fast development with Vite's HMR, type-safe coding with TypeScript, and a pre-configured setup with Prettier and ESLint Motivation Biggest reason for adopting Prettier is to stop all the ongoing debates over styles [^whyprettier]. 1, 10. 1, 9. Start using eslint-plugin-prettier in your project by running `npm i eslint-plugin ESLint plugin for Prettier formatting. Latest version: 5. 2. 5. js file that launches Runs prettier as an eslint rule. Contribute to prettier/eslint-plugin-prettier development by creating an account on GitHub. Most stylistic rules are unnecessary when using Prettier, but worse – they might conflict with Prettier! Use Prettier for code formatting concerns, and linters for code-quality concerns, as outlined in This article compared Prettier and ESLint to help you decide which tool best fits your JavaScript development needs or how to use them together. Installing an affected package executes an install. For example, ESLint's indent rule might require 4 spaces Contribute to Tyran169/blue-eyes development by creating an account on GitHub. When both tools run, they can produce contradictory requirements. eslint-config-prettier Turns off all rules that are unnecessary or might conflict with Prettier. Please read Integrating with linters before installing. ESLint is a static code analyzer. This release fixes several bugs found in Turns off all rules that are unnecessary or might conflict with Prettier. Compare eslint-plugin-prettier and styled-system - features, pros, cons, and real-world usage from developers. With automated formatting and linting, In this article, you'll learn how to set up an excellent linting solution with ESLint and Prettier in your project. . 6, and 10. Start using eslint-config-prettier in Contribute to ThaiDevv/library-management development by creating an account on GitHub. Runs Prettier as an ESLint rule and reports differences as individual ESLint issues. 1 released We just pushed ESLint v10. 1. 7 has embedded malicious code for a supply chain compromise. 10. For legacy configuration, this plugin By using Prettier and ESLint together, you can create a robust development environment that encourages code quality and consistency. js file that launches eslint-config-prettier 8. 8, last published: 8 months ago. Latest version: 10. You will get to know the ESLint Prettier Rules that are needed About A modern web application template built with React, Vite, and TypeScript. eslintrc files, Prettier also controls these same aspects but with its own logic. If your desired formatting does not match Prettier’s output, you should use a different tool such as prettier-eslint instead. Using First, we have plugins that let you run Prettier as if it was a linter rule: eslint-plugin-prettier stylelint-prettier These plugins were especially useful when Prettier was Published 17 Apr, 2026 under Release Notes ESLint v10. It provides expert guidance on migrating legacy . Prettier — all formatting (indentation, quotes, line length, trailing commas, etc. Setup ESLint and Prettier on a React app with a precommit In this part, we will see how to setup Prettier, husky, and lint-staged on an app This guide shows a clean ESLint/Prettier split, a modern setup for TypeScript and React, and high-ROI rules that protect boundaries (including Using Prettier and ESLint together can enhance your JavaScript dev workflow by maintaining a consistent code style and fixing code issues. Our recommended configuration automatically enables eslint-config-prettier to disable all formatting-related ESLint rules. wli, bbj, kon, dqe, lmc, bzd, kzk, esk, bzy, yvj, ypv, hpz, qrb, ggq, bpa,